Node.js / TypeScript

There’s no published Node SDK yet, but the API is small enough that fetch is the right tool. The example below works on Node 20+ (built-in fetch) and on any modern browser-side runtime.

fedshield.ts

The submit helper above lets 409 through because a duplicate event submission is success, not failure. The Federation Core returns 409 when the same event_id is replayed, including the original received_at. Treat 409 the same as 201.

const result = await submitEvent('report_cheating', 'alice-123', 0.85);
if (result.duplicate) {
console.log('event already stored; retry was a no-op');
}
  • crypto.randomUUID() is built-in on Node 18+ and in modern browsers. On older Node, install uuid and use uuidv4().
  • fetch is built-in on Node 18+. On older Node, use undici or node-fetch.
  • process.env reading happens at module load — for a production setup, pass these as injected config to the module instead.
